How do South Dakota's climate and rural roads affect my BMW's maintenance needs?

The harsh winters with road salt and gravel, combined with long stretches of rural highway driving, can accelerate wear on your BMW's undercarriage, suspension components, and cooling systems. It's crucial to have regular undercarriage inspections and more frequent washes to combat corrosion, and to ensure tires and all-wheel-drive systems are in top condition for variable road surfaces.

What are the most common BMW repair issues for drivers in this area?

Beyond general wear from rural driving, common issues include problems with the cooling system (thermostats, water pumps), oil leaks from valve cover and oil filter housing gaskets, and suspension wear (control arms, bushings) due to road conditions. Battery-related electrical issues are also frequent, as cold winters are demanding on older batteries.

How can I find a trustworthy mechanic for my BMW near Hosmer?

Seek recommendations from other European car owners in the area or local online community groups. When contacting shops in Aberdeen or other nearby towns, specifically ask about their experience with BMW models, their diagnostic tool capabilities (like ISTA/INPA), and if they use OEM or high-quality aftermarket parts. A willingness to provide references is a good sign.

Is BMW repair more expensive in this region due to the lack of local specialists?

Labor rates may be slightly lower than in major cities, but the cost of repairs is often influenced by the need to source specialized parts, which can incur shipping delays and costs to rural areas. Building a relationship with a reputable regional shop can help manage costs through accurate diagnostics and preventative maintenance advice tailored to local conditions.
